In my case, the gentle grinding noises were barely noticeable at 53k miles. What prompted me to take the car in for service was intermittent hesitation when slowing down from speed and trying to speed up again, as one would when approaching a red light and then trying to get back up to speed before coming to a full stop once the light turned green again. My service supervisor told me it was the transmission. Acura replaced it for free and I didn't even pay for labor. This all happened prior to the tranny recall. At 75k miles, the engine light came on three consecutive weeks costing me a total of $600 to replace things such as temperature sensors, fuel pumps and even a gas cap.
